US: Russia cannot stop NATO expansion

US State Secretary Condoleezza Rice
The US says it will not allow Russia to take advantage of its military victory over Georgia and veto NATO entry for former Soviet states.

"We will not permit Russia to veto the future of NATO, neither the countries offered membership nor their decision to accept it," secretary of state Condoleezza Rice said n an interview published Sunday in the Typos newspaper.

Rice's comments come while Moscow has repeatedly criticized NATO plans for an eastward expansion, which is an open breach of a NATO promise made to the last Soviet Union Secretary General Mikhail Gorbachev upon the union's 1991 dismemberment.

"We and our European allies will give our help to Georgia...The United States and Europe strongly support the independence and the territorial integrity of Russia's neighbors," Rice said, Reuters reported.

At an April summit, NATO stopped short of putting Ukraine and Georgia immediately on the path to joining the transatlantic military alliance, but pledged that the two ex-Soviet states would one day become members.

Despite Washington's strong support for Georgia and Ukraine's NATO membership bid, US allies including Germany and France are reluctant towards provoking Russia.

Ukraine's NATO bid is also facing opposition at home where many citizents favor ties with Russia.
